Before initiating a reshard, confirm that replication lag on all existing shards is below the five-second threshold and that the dual-write flag is enabled in the Wardell config service. The reshard proceeds in three phases: backfill, shadow-read verification, and cutover. Do not schedule a cutover within 24 hours of a product release; coordinate the freeze window with the Halvorsen team first. The complete phase checklist, including abort criteria and rollback commands, is maintained on the internal operations page.

dashboard of bahaf-tageg = https://jira.zemvarlabs.internal/projects/projects/browse/projects

## Canary Gating Rules — Lanternbuild Provenance

Before promoting any Lanternbuild artifact past the canary stage, the release manager must confirm that provenance attestation succeeded, that the canary cohort ran for the full 90-minute soak window, and that error budgets on the Quillhaven cluster remained within threshold. Promotions lacking a verified attestation chain are blocked automatically by the gatekeeper. For audit purposes, record the token emitted at attestation time below.

session token of tajef-bageg = htk21_5d90d574934f3ccae6437

# Artifact Signing — Graphlace

Graphlace (our dependency graph visualizer) ships signed artifacts only. Build via `make release`, sign before upload, verify on CI. Unsigned builds are rejected by the Fernwick registry. Rotation happens quarterly; check the rotation log first. Never commit keys to the repo. For local verification during onboarding, use the current signing key below:

rollout seal: bky4_x7Gc

## Idempotency Keys for Payment Retries (Lumopay)

Every retry of a charge request must reuse the original idempotency key; generating a new key on retry can produce duplicate charges. Keys are scoped per merchant and expire after 48 hours. Reviewers should verify keys are derived server-side, never from client input. The full key-generation specification and threat model are maintained on the internal page.

dashboard of kaguf-tawip = https://vault.merlaqsys.test/issue